Title: Innovator Spotlight: Vinodh Venkatesan

Introduction: Vinodh Venkatesan, based in Waedenswil, Switzerland, is a prolific inventor with an impressive portfolio of 19 patents. His contributions to the field of data management and cognitive storage systems have established him as a notable figure in the technology sector.

Latest Patents: Vinodh's latest patents include innovative methods that significantly enhance the management of datasets in cognitive storage systems. One such invention involves a computer-implemented method for effectively managing datasets labeled with respective metadata. The process utilizes spiking neural networks (SNN) to learn representations of classes and infer class labels for unlabeled datasets. This advanced approach allows for organized dataset management based on learned class labels, facilitating more efficient data handling.

Another remarkable patent focuses on creating a storage system that includes multiple storage tiers and a methodology for relocating data segments. This invention enhances the capacity management of storage units, employs access pattern evaluation, and integrates a classification unit for optimized data storage solutions.

Career Highlights: Vinodh Venkatesan has made significant strides in his career, working at the renowned International Business Machines Corporation (IBM). His expertise in data management and storage solutions has garnered attention and admiration within the industry.

Collaborations: Throughout his career, Vinodh has collaborated with esteemed colleagues, including Ilias Iliadis and Giovanni Cherubini. These partnerships have undoubtedly contributed to the innovative projects and patents that Vinodh has developed.
